#5162ae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5162ae is composed of 31.8% red, 38.4% green and 68.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.4% cyan, 43.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 31.8% black. It has a hue angle of 229 degrees, a saturation of 36.5% and a lightness of 50%. #5162ae color hex could be obtained by blending #a2c4ff with #00005d.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

#5162ae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5162ae has RGB values of R:81, G:98, B:174 and CMYK values of C:0.53, M:0.44, Y:0, K:0.32. Its decimal value is 5333678.
